This 16,880-square-foot property on 0.89 acres offers a rare redevelopment opportunity in the historic Frenchtown district of St. Charles, Missouri. The site is strategically positioned outside the 500-year flood plain and currently zoned I-2, providing flexibility for future commercial uses. A conditional use permit (CUP) is already approved for alcohol sales and microbrewery operations, making this ideal for hospitality or entertainment concepts.
Surrounding infrastructure upgrades and streetscape improvements are underway through the Frenchtown Great Streets Plan, including enhanced lighting, underground utilities, and improved connectivity with the Boscher Greenway leading to the Katy Trail. With proximity to Historic Main Street, the Foundry Art Centre, and multiple redevelopment projects, the property benefits from steady traffic and regional tourism.
